Transaction c88af150f248d24a638b584bc097a6210c0703e085d38efcf6cb70c2a4a20388

1 Input
2 Outputs
  • c88af150f248d24a638b584bc097a6210c0703e085d38efcf6cb70c2a4a20388:0
  • value  1680000
    address  33KsNgCE3iDsHp17Vfh84ek2C5kdapc3Vi
  • c88af150f248d24a638b584bc097a6210c0703e085d38efcf6cb70c2a4a20388:1
  • value  971682
    address  1PxS7grAri2dPfyyA4RDXwGaFtRKe8bKiy